Hi Brindlepath integrations team,

Quick note for your security review of the Fernloop CSV import wizard: column mapping now happens client-side, and we strip formula-looking cells before upload. Row limits are enforced server-side too. To exercise the sandbox endpoint during your review, authenticate with the token below.

Thanks,
Marisol

session JWT of yawep-yawep = eyJhbGciOiJIUzI1NiIsInR5cCI6IkpXVCJ9.eyJzdWIiOiI3pWF3_In0.aXYsHiog

The garage occupancy feed for the Brindlewood campus arrives over a message queue every thirty seconds, one record per level, published by the Stallgrid edge boxes. Counts can briefly go negative when a sensor double-fires on exit; the ingest job clamps these to zero and flags the interval. If the feed stalls for more than five minutes, the dashboard falls back to the last known snapshot. Sensor mappings, queue names, and the replay procedure are documented on the internal page below.

runbook for tahog-kadug: https://gitlab.qirvanworks.corp/projects/pages/view/b139298aed28

## Scaling Engine (excerpt)

Plugin authors extending the Ladlewise recipe-scaling calculator should note that scaling is not purely linear: leavening, salt, and spice quantities are damped by configurable exponents, and rounding snaps to kitchen-friendly increments. Your plugin may override these per-ingredient, but defaults apply whenever a category is unmapped. The default tuning constants are defined as follows.

constants for kahag-yagag:
BUDGETS = {
    "tamax": 449,
    "holiel": 156,
    "isteth": 181,
    "silath": 575,
    "zorys": 821,
    "briax": 1007,
    "quenox": 276,
}

// MAX_CATALOGUE_BATCH: cap on records per import run.
// Context for the sync: the Bramblewood Library feed spikes
// to ~40k rows on quarterly refreshes and the Ostrell parser
// chokes above 5k. Do not raise without load-testing the
// dedupe pass. Last validated import ran under the build token noted below.

build token for kajeg-bageg: htk6_abeb3e